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/videolan/dav1d.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
path: root/src/cdf.h
diff options
context:
space:
mode:
authorRonald S. Bultje <rsbultje@gmail.com>2018-11-18 04:55:44 +0300
committerRonald S. Bultje <rsbultje@gmail.com>2018-11-25 21:38:31 +0300
commit7cc54b91a4f5351a70149eb1e97ea2f71b0bf873 (patch)
tree1422d512897f3a2f4751caa84d0e7aa597a1f35b /src/cdf.h
parent03d4ede0656490a384e2a2ffe10b16c5aabdc8ec (diff)
Move Av1FrameHeader and Av1SequenceHeader into public headers
Add DAV1D_/Dav1d prefix to everything.
Diffstat (limited to 'src/cdf.h')
-rw-r--r--src/cdf.h6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/cdf.h b/src/cdf.h
index 1a83987..ee2acb5 100644
--- a/src/cdf.h
+++ b/src/cdf.h
@@ -40,7 +40,7 @@ typedef struct CdfModeContext {
uint16_t filter_intra[5 + 1];
uint16_t uv_mode[2][N_INTRA_PRED_MODES][N_UV_INTRA_PRED_MODES + 1];
uint16_t angle_delta[8][8];
- uint16_t filter[2][8][N_SWITCHABLE_FILTERS + 1];
+ uint16_t filter[2][8][DAV1D_N_SWITCHABLE_FILTERS + 1];
uint16_t newmv_mode[6][2];
uint16_t globalmv_mode[2][2];
uint16_t refmv_mode[6][2];
@@ -68,7 +68,7 @@ typedef struct CdfModeContext {
uint16_t skip_mode[3][2];
uint16_t partition[N_BL_LEVELS][4][N_PARTITIONS + 1];
uint16_t seg_pred[3][2];
- uint16_t seg_id[3][NUM_SEGMENTS + 1];
+ uint16_t seg_id[3][DAV1D_NUM_SEGMENTS + 1];
uint16_t cfl_sign[8 + 1];
uint16_t cfl_alpha[6][16 + 1];
uint16_t restore_wiener[2];
@@ -132,7 +132,7 @@ typedef struct CdfThreadContext {
} CdfThreadContext;
void dav1d_init_states(CdfThreadContext *cdf, int qidx);
-void dav1d_update_tile_cdf(const Av1FrameHeader *hdr, CdfContext *dst,
+void dav1d_update_tile_cdf(const Dav1dFrameHeader *hdr, CdfContext *dst,
const CdfContext *src);
void dav1d_cdf_thread_alloc(CdfThreadContext *cdf, struct thread_data *t);